Places to stay in Aspen Hill, Maryland
Aspen Hill is community and an unincorporated area in Montgomery County, Maryland. It got its name from aspen trees that once were found near the first post office in the area. The post office was located in a general store on what was then known as the Washington-Brookeville Pike and opened around 1864.
